If a ball rolls at high speed out of a circular tube resting on a table, will the ball continue in circular motion once it leaves the tube? Why?
No, the centripetal force is no longer acting on the ball. Due to inertia, the ball will move in a straight line out of the tube.

How does the speed of an object traveling in a circle relate to the radius of the circle? Assuming the time it takes for one revolution is the always the same.
speed is directly proportional to the radius of the circle. If the radius doubles, the speed doubles.
